SAP BTP Developer

Stellar Consulting Solutions
North Brunswick Township, United States of America
yesterday

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English

Job location

North Brunswick Township, United States of America

Tech stack

Java
JavaScript
ABAP
API
Application Performance Management
User Authentication
Build Automation
Azure
Software as a Service
Cloud Computing
Cloud Foundry
Computer Programming
Continuous Integration
Software Debugging
DevOps
Github
Monitoring of Systems
Python
Node.js
Open Data Protocol
SAP Applications
SAP HANA
SAP Project System
Secure Coding
Software Deployment
SAP Business Technology Platform
Backend
SAP Fiori
Build Management
Adobe
SAPBasis
Containerization
Git Flow
Kubernetes
SAP S/4HANA
REST
Software Version Control
Docker
Jenkins
Custom Reports
Microservices

Job description

The SAP BTP Developer will be responsible for designing, developing, and deploying applications on the SAP Business Technology Platform (BTP). The role requires strong expertise in SAP BTP services, cloud application development, and automation of build and deployment processes using CI/CD pipelines. The ideal candidate will have experience in integrating SAP and non-SAP systems, leveraging BTP capabilities, and ensuring efficient, automated delivery of solutions.

Requirements

Technical Skills:

  • Strong knowledge of SAP BTP services (Cloud Foundry, Kyma, CAP, SAP HANA Cloud).
  • Proficiency in programming languages: Java, Node.js, JavaScript, or Python or ABAP-RAP on SAP BTP
  • Experience with SAP Fiori/UI5 development and integrate with backend systems via OData and REST APIs.
  • Connecting CAPM apps with SAP S/4HANA, SAP HANA Cloud, and third-party systems via destinations and APIs.
  • Hands-on experience with CI/CD tools (Jenkins, GitHub Actions, Azure DevOps, or SAP CI/CD).
  • Familiarity with containerization (Docker, Kubernetes) and cloud-native development.
  • Clean Core Backend Development on S/4
  • Integrates S/4HANA with external systems via APIs and events.
  • Builds in-app extensions using RAP and BAdIs.
  • Exposure to EML.
  • Exposure to CFL for BO Extensions: CFL + Extensibility
  • Exposure to AIF, Adobe forms, BRF+
  • Works on custom reports, enhancements, and CDS views, Analytical CDS Views, AMDP, OData
  • Ensures compliance with SAP's clean core guidelines

Build Automation Expertise:

  • Experience in automating builds, deployments, and testing processes.
  • Knowledge of DevOps practices and tools for SAP environments.
  • Apply best practices for authentication, authorization, and secure coding on SAP BTP.
  • Manage roles and authorizations using SAP Identity Authentication and Identity Provisioning services.

Other Skills:

  • Strong understanding of REST/OData APIs and microservices architecture.
  • Familiarity with Git-based workflows and version control.
  • Monitor application performance using SAP BTP monitoring tools and optimize scalability.
  • Good problem-solving and debugging skills.
  • Experience in Life Sciences or Manufacturing industry with strong business process knowhow

Apply for this position